R/print.trace_length.R

Defines functions print.trace_length

Documented in print.trace_length

#' @title Trace length Print
#'
#' @description  Print Trace length Information
#' @param x Data to print
#' @param ... Additional arguments
#' @method print trace_length

#' @export

print.trace_length <- function(x, ...) {
	data <- x

	if(attr(data, "level") == "log" & is.null(attr(data, "groups"))) {
		attr(data, "raw") <- NULL
		attr(data, "level") <- NULL
		attr(data, "mapping") <- NULL
		class(data) <- c("numeric")
		print.default(data)
	}
	else {
		print(tibble::trunc_mat(data))
	}
}
gertjanssenswillen/edeaR documentation built on July 22, 2019, 7:08 p.m.